Do optometrists in Clear Brook accept my vision or medical insurance?
Most optometry practices in the Clear Brook area accept major vision insurance plans like VSP, EyeMed, and Davis Vision, as well as medical insurance (e.g., Medicare, Anthem, Aetna) for medical eye exams. However, due to the smaller number of practices compared to larger cities, it is crucial to call ahead. Verify directly with the optometrist's office whether they are in-network for your specific plan and what your co-pay or deductible might be for a comprehensive exam or specialized testing.
What should I consider when choosing between the optometry practices near Clear Brook?
When choosing in the Clear Brook area, consider the practice's hours and availability, as some may have limited days open. Look at the range of optical services on-site; some offices have a full optical dispensary with a wide frame selection, while others may primarily focus on exams and refer you elsewhere for glasses. Consider if you need a specialist, such as for advanced dry eye treatment or myopia control for children. Also, evaluate the convenience of location, as you may need to travel to nearby Winchester for more options or specific technology.
How far in advance do I typically need to book an eye exam with a Clear Brook optometrist?
For a routine eye exam with a popular optometrist in the Clear Brook area, it's common to need to schedule an appointment 2 to 4 weeks in advance, especially for evenings or Saturdays. New patient appointments may require even more lead time. For urgent issues like sudden vision changes or eye injuries, most practices will try to accommodate same-day or next-day appointments, so it's always worth calling. Booking during the fall (before insurance benefits expire) and summer (before school starts) tends to be the busiest.
